As an Information System Assurance (IS) Associate in our Assurance practice, you will begin to utilize your educational background as well as your organizational skills as you serve the firm's dynamic client base. You will assist in problem solving and fact-finding, working side-by-side with more experienced team members who can provide you with direction, coaching and learning opportunities. You will have the opportunity to gain an understanding of the IT environment during fieldwork by interviewing various client personnel and performing an IT general controls risk assessment in various areas including, but not limited to new hire and terminated user controls testing, user access controls testing, and program change controls testing. Further, you will have an opportunity to work within engagement teams to develop recommendations that will help clients improve their controls environments and help develop audit strategies to respond to controls findings you discover.
